Output edfa4eea4d9f0ee2697aa833c4a3787f9482b269dfd1e4effcf12a325637fbce:2

value
42872509
script pubkey
OP_0 OP_PUSHBYTES_20 4080783bb811d9eb37760a626f95c249655fd4f2
address
bc1qgzq8swacz8v7kdmkpf3xl9wzf9j4l48jc7e2mk
transaction
edfa4eea4d9f0ee2697aa833c4a3787f9482b269dfd1e4effcf12a325637fbce
confirmations
1882
spent
true